Output d1520acee85df3b47711593de17cddbfb19ec8d3dbefacadb25be82a4470028a:10

value
8586342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c89b2db3e31e373e4499038f1a9c6232a56c1457 OP_EQUAL
address
3KyixuKT6gEiqBha9Gcxg8h6Pv9qZP1qNK
transaction
d1520acee85df3b47711593de17cddbfb19ec8d3dbefacadb25be82a4470028a
spent
true